Framingham Community Theater Presents The Dixie Swim Club

Tonight, Aug. 1 is opening night. Amazing Things Arts Center and Framingham Community Theater are staging six shows.

Looking for a girls night out?

Then the newest production by Framingham Community Theatre - The Dixie Swim Club - might be the perfect answer.


The play is about friendship and five Southern women who met in college on the swim team and then get together every August in North Carolina over three decades. The comedic play focuses on four of those weekends.

The characters in the show include Sheree, the spunky team captain, who is desperately trying to maintain her “perfect” life. Dinah, the wisecracking overachiever with her career but who is struggling in her personal life. Lexie who is trying to hold on to her youth and looks and a marriage, as she has been married over and over and over. Vernadette whose life is chaotic. And Jeri who decided to become a mother very late in life.


The women rely on each other to get through life’s ups and down in their career and personal affairs.


The cast includes Kay Gross as Sheree, Tricia Akowicz as Dinah, Jyoti Daniere as Lexie, Catherine Verow as Jeri and Shelley Wood as Vernadette.


The show is directed by Cindy Bell.
